H2: Understanding the Importance of Mental Wellness

H3: The Impact of Stress on Your Mental Health

Chronic stress can lead to a myriad of mental health issues, including anxiety and depression. Recognizing how it affects your thoughts, feelings, and behaviors is the first step towards fostering resilience.

H3: The Benefits of Mindfulness

Practicing mindfulness can enhance your emotional regulation, improve your focus, and reduce symptoms of anxiety. This awareness allows you to pause and assess your thoughts and feelings without judgment.

H2: 10 Mindful Strategies for Managing Stress

H3: 1. Practice Deep Breathing

Deep breathing exercises can reduce stress and promote relaxation. Spend a few minutes each day focusing on your breath—inhale deeply through your nose, hold it for a few moments, and exhale slowly through your mouth.

H3: 2. Engage in Regular Meditation

Meditation helps clear your mind and find stillness in the chaos of life. Consider setting aside at least 10 minutes daily to meditate, focusing on your inner thoughts and feelings without distraction.

H3: 3. Keep a Journal

Journaling can be a therapeutic outlet for processing emotions. Write down your thoughts, stressors, and any positive experiences to foster a sense of gratitude and reflection.

H3: 4. Connect with Nature

Spending time in nature has a profound impact on mental health. Whether it’s a walk in the park or gardening, immersing yourself in the natural world can help ground you and alleviate stress.

H3: 5. Set Boundaries

Learning to say “no” is an essential skill in managing stress. Protect your personal time and energy by establishing boundaries that preserve your mental wellness.

H3: 6. Physical Activity

Regular exercise releases endorphins, which naturally elevate your mood. Consider integrating activities you enjoy, whether it be yoga, dancing, or jogging, into your daily routine.

H3: 7. Mindful Eating

Pay attention to what you eat and how it makes you feel. Nourishing your body with healthy foods can impact your mental state, fueling both your body and mind.

H3: 8. Cultivate Social Connections

Building and maintaining strong relationships can offer support during tough times. Share your feelings with trusted friends or family, and don’t hesitate to ask for help.

H3: 9. Limit Screen Time

Digital devices can add to our stress levels. Set aside dedicated times to unplug from screens and engage in offline activities such as reading, creating art, or spending quality time with loved ones.

H3: 10. Seek Professional Help

If stress becomes unmanageable, consider reaching out to a mental health professional. Therapy can provide valuable coping strategies and a safe space to explore your concerns.

H2: FAQ

H3: What are some signs that I need to manage my stress more effectively?

Signs include persistent feelings of overwhelm, anxiety, irritability, changes in appetite or sleep patterns, and difficulty concentrating. If they persist, it may be time to implement some mindfulness techniques.

H3: How long does it take to see improvements in my stress levels with mindfulness?

While some individuals may notice improvements within a few weeks, consistency is key. Regular practice can build resilience over time, leading to more profound and lasting benefits.

H3: Can mindfulness techniques be used in the workplace?

Absolutely! Mindfulness techniques, such as taking short breaks for deep breathing or practicing gratitude during team meetings, can help create a more supportive workplace environment that enhances overall productivity and mental wellness.
